Optimal Timing for Driveway Grindings
Driveway pavement grindings are a byproduct of asphalt or concrete surface removal processes. The timing of when to perform driveway pavement grindings depends on various factors including weather conditions, pavement condition, and project goals. Proper scheduling ensures optimal results and minimizes disruptions.
Late spring through early fall is ideal for driveway pavement grindings due to stable weather and dry conditions, which facilitate efficient work and proper material handling.
Avoid scheduled grindings during periods of heavy rain, snow, or extreme cold, as moisture and low temperatures can compromise the quality of the process and the durability of the surface.
Perform grindings when the pavement shows signs of deterioration or surface damage, but before structural integrity is compromised, to maximize the lifespan of the driveway.
Coordinate with other construction or maintenance activities to ensure minimal disruption and optimal resource allocation during the scheduling of driveway pavement grindings.

Driveway pavement grindings involve the removal of the top layers of asphalt or concrete to prepare for resurfacing or repair. The process typically uses specialized equipment to grind down the existing surface, creating debris that can be recycled or disposed of properly. Proper timing ensures that the process is efficient and that the driveway remains functional for as long as possible.

Timely pavement grinding can extend the lifespan of a driveway by removing damaged or worn surfaces before structural issues develop. Scheduling during appropriate weather conditions and seasons reduces the risk of delays and ensures the quality of the work. Regular assessment of pavement condition helps determine the best timing for grinding projects.
